“LEGS” DIAMOND
CONVICTED AT LAST. United Preso Association —By Electric telegraph.—Copyright i NEW YORK., August 8. , “Legs” Diamond, the gang leader, whose wonndings were cab ed on October 12th, and April 27th last was finally convicted of felony, after many contests with the law. He was foil'll 1 guilty to-day of violating the Pro'lli bition Act by maintaining an illicit st-11, and he faces a sentence of four years, and a fine of eleven thousand dollars. Diamond was recently acquitted of a charge" of torturing a farmer during his beer running activities. The gangster will probably appoa against to-day’s conviction.
